Twitter iPhone pliant OnePlus 11 PS5 Disney+ Orange Livebox Windows 11

Lenny/Problème reconnaissance Scanner

11 réponses
Avatar
Grégory Bulot
Bonjour,=20

Apr=C3=A8s red=C3=A9marrage de mon pc, la fonction scanner de ma HP750Cxi
(combin=C3=A9 Imprimante/Scanner) n'est plus d=C3=A9tect=C3=A9 !


Je ne trouve pas la source du probl=C3=A8me :

$ scanimage -L
device `net:192.168.1.138:hpaio:/usb/OfficeJet_G55?serial=3DSGF0AEHQ6TVL'
is a Hewlett-Packard OfficeJet_G55 all-in-one
=3D> la G55 est effectivement un autre combin=C3=A9 HP Imprimante/scanner =
=20
(scanner HS)
=3D> si je fais depuis 192.168.1.138 le scanimage -L seul la G55 est
d=C3=A9tect=C3=A9


$ lsusb | grep 750
Bus 002 Device 005: ID 03f0:1511 Hewlett-Packard PSC 750xi

$ grep hp /etc/sane.d/dll.conf=20
hp
hp3900
hpsj5s
hp3500
hp4200
hp5400
hp5590
hpljm1005


Si je tente le scanimage -L depuis un pc distant (192.168.1.125), ou
en 127.0.0.1, en local tout semble se passer correctement :

Dec 30 15:36:06 morpheus saned[20571]: saned (AF-indep+IPv6) from
sane-backends 1.0.19 starting up=20
Dec 30 15:36:06 morpheus saned[20571]:
check_host: access by remote host: 192.168.1.125=20
Dec 30 15:36:06
morpheus saned[20571]: init: access granted to gbulot@192.168.1.125

Syslog concernant l'imprimante/scanner

Dec 30 17:52:00 morpheus hal_lpadmin: URIs:
['usb://HP/PSC%20750xi?serial=3DHU22IDT1PTWB',
'hal:///org/freedesktop/Hal/devices/usb_device_3f0_1511_HU22IDT1PTWB_if0_pr=
inter_HU22IDT1PTWB']

Dec 30 17:52:00 morpheus hal_lpadmin: HPLIP Fax URIs: None Dec 30
17:52:00 morpheus hal_lpadmin: Not adding printer:
Hewlett-Packard_PSC_750xi already exists=20

Dec 30 17:52:00 morpheus
NetworkManager: <debug> [1293727920.614073] nm_hal_device_added(): New
device added (hal udi is
'/org/freedesktop/Hal/devices/usb_device_3f0_1511_HU22IDT1PTWB_if0_printer_=
HU22IDT1PTWB').

J'ai d=C3=A9j=C3=A0 suprim=C3=A9 ~/.sane : aucun changement

# /etc/init.d/openbsd-inetd stop ; sleep 5s ; saned -d=20
[saned] main: starting debug mode (level 2)
[saned] saned (AF-indep+IPv6) from sane-backends 1.0.19 starting up
[saned] do_bindings: [1] bind failed: Address already in use
=3D> pourtant netstat -peanut | grep 6566 ne renvoie rien



--
Cordialement=20
Gr=C3=A9gory BULOT

--
Lisez la FAQ de la liste avant de poser une question :
http://wiki.debian.org/fr/FrenchLists

Pour vous DESABONNER, envoyez un message avec comme objet "unsubscribe"
vers debian-user-french-REQUEST@lists.debian.org
En cas de soucis, contactez EN ANGLAIS listmaster@lists.debian.org
Archive: http://lists.debian.org/20101230190126.5d274bda@morpheus.bulot-fr.com

10 réponses

1 2
Avatar
Jean-Yves F. Barbier
On Thu, 30 Dec 2010 19:01:26 +0100, Grégory Bulot
wrote:

...
# /etc/init.d/openbsd-inetd stop ; sleep 5s ; saned -d
[saned] main: starting debug mode (level 2)
[saned] saned (AF-indep+IPv6) from sane-backends 1.0.19 starting up
[saned] do_bindings: [1] bind failed: Address already in use
=> pourtant netstat -peanut | grep 6566 ne renvoie rien



le mien répond la même chose, mais le grep revoie une connection.
réessaye avec -d128 pour voir,
et que dit un: ls -al /dev/sg*|grep sca ?

--
May be too intense for some viewers.

--
Lisez la FAQ de la liste avant de poser une question :
http://wiki.debian.org/fr/FrenchLists

Pour vous DESABONNER, envoyez un message avec comme objet "unsubscribe"
vers
En cas de soucis, contactez EN ANGLAIS
Archive: http://lists.debian.org/
Avatar
Grégory Bulot
Bonjour, Bonsoir,

Reprise de votre mail en citation, reponses éventuelles au fil du texte

Le Thu, 30 Dec 2010 19:58:44 +0100, Jean-Yves F. Barbier, vous avez
écrit :

On Thu, 30 Dec 2010 19:01:26 +0100, Grégory Bulot
wrote:



le mien répond la même chose, mais le grep revoie une connectio n.
réessaye avec -d128 pour voir,



[saned] main: starting debug mode (level 128)
[saned] read_config: searching for config file
[saned] read_config: done reading config
[saned] saned (AF-indep+IPv6) from sane-backends 1.0.21 starting up
[saned] do_bindings: trying to get port for service
"sane-port" (getaddrinfo) [saned] do_bindings: [1] socket () using IPv6
[saned] do_bindings: [1] setsockopt ()
[saned] do_bindings: [1] bind () to port 6566
[saned] do_bindings: [1] listen ()
[saned] do_bindings: [0] socket () using IPv4
[saned] do_bindings: [0] setsockopt ()
[saned] do_bindings: [0] bind () to port 6566
[saned] do_bindings: [0] bind failed: Address already in use
[saned] run_standalone: spawning Avahi process
[saned] run_standalone: waiting for control connection
[saned] saned_avahi_callback: AVAHI_CLIENT_S_RUNNING
[saned] saned_create_avahi_services: adding service 'saned'
[saned] saned_avahi_group_callback: service 'saned' successfully
established

=> scanimage -L :

[saned] handle_connection: processing client connection
[saned] check_host: access by remote host: ::1
[saned] check_host: remote host is IN6_LOOPBACK: access granted
[saned] init: access granted
[saned] init: access granted to gbulot@::1
[saned] process_request: waiting for request
[saned] process_request: got request 1
[saned] process_request: waiting for request
[saned] process_request: got request 10
[saned] bailing out, waiting for children...
[saned] bail_out: all children exited


et que dit un: ls -al /dev/sg*|grep sca ?



rien, ensemble vide


par contre, je viens de passer en squeeze *sane*, scanimage se termine
par une erruer de segmentation après avoir vu la G55 (ma libc6 ét ait en
squeeze, j'ai du du merder y'a quelques temps entre
stable/testing/backports)

--
Cordialement
Grégory BULOT

--
Lisez la FAQ de la liste avant de poser une question :
http://wiki.debian.org/fr/FrenchLists

Pour vous DESABONNER, envoyez un message avec comme objet "unsubscribe"
vers
En cas de soucis, contactez EN ANGLAIS
Archive: http://lists.debian.org/
Avatar
Grégory Bulot
Bonjour, Bonsoir,

Pour info, actuellement ce qui touche au scanner en est à ces versions

$ dpkg-query -W sane sane-utils libsane xsane libusb-0.1-4
libsane 1.0.21-9
libusb-0.1-4 2:0.1.12-16
sane 1.0.14-9
sane-utils 1.0.21-9
xsane 0.997-2+b1


--
Cordialement
Grégory BULOT

--
Lisez la FAQ de la liste avant de poser une question :
http://wiki.debian.org/fr/FrenchLists

Pour vous DESABONNER, envoyez un message avec comme objet "unsubscribe"
vers
En cas de soucis, contactez EN ANGLAIS
Archive: http://lists.debian.org/
Avatar
Jean-Yves F. Barbier
On Fri, 31 Dec 2010 12:36:07 +0100, Grégory Bulot
wrote:

Pour info, actuellement ce qui touche au scanner en est à ces versio ns

$ dpkg-query -W sane sane-utils libsane xsane libusb-0.1-4
libsane 1.0.21-9
libusb-0.1-4 2:0.1.12-16
sane 1.0.14-9
sane-utils 1.0.21-9
xsane 0.997-2+b1



sous sid, dpkg -l *sane*:
ii gimp2.0-quiteinsane 0.3-9
ii libsane 1.0.21-9
ii libsane-extras 1.0.21.2
ii libsane-hpaio 3.10.6-1.1
ii python-imaging-sane 1.1.7-2
ii sane 1.0.14-9
ii sane-utils 1.0.21-9
ii xsane 0.997-2+b1
ii xsane-common 0.997-2

donc rien de différent à priori.

et que dit un: ls -al /dev/sg*|grep sca ?


rien, ensemble vide



Par contre, ça, ça n'est pas normal, mais ça correspond à   ce que tu as dis:
pas de détection de la bête (==pas de device créé)

...

par contre, je viens de passer en squeeze *sane*, scanimage se termine
par une erruer de segmentation après avoir vu la G55 (ma libc6 à ©tait en
squeeze, j'ai du du merder y'a quelques temps entre
stable/testing/backports)





Evidemment si tout est mélangé, ça risque de ne pas le faire.

tu peux tjrs essayer de voir ce que dit un: strace saned -d128
mais à mon avis le temps de trouver où ça merdouille, soit t u réinstalles
propre, soit tu migres en sid.

--
Hugh Hefner is a virgin.

--
Lisez la FAQ de la liste avant de poser une question :
http://wiki.debian.org/fr/FrenchLists

Pour vous DESABONNER, envoyez un message avec comme objet "unsubscribe"
vers
En cas de soucis, contactez EN ANGLAIS
Archive: http://lists.debian.org/
Avatar
Grégory Bulot
Bonjour, Bonsoir,

Le Fri, 31 Dec 2010 13:46:07 +0100, Jean-Yves F. Barbier, vous avez
écrit :



sous sid, dpkg -l *sane*:
donc rien de différent à priori.



Oui, j'ai vu que sid et testing avaient les mêmes versions


>> et que dit un: ls -al /dev/sg*|grep sca ?
>rien, ensemble vide

Par contre, ça, ça n'est pas normal, mais ça correspond à ce que tu
as dis: pas de détection de la bête (==pas de device crà ©Ã©)



au moins de ce côté c'est cohérent (culte de la pensée posistive)

>> par contre, je viens de passer en squeeze *sane*, scanimage se
>> termine par une erruer de segmentation après avoir vu la G55 (ma
>> libc6 était en squeeze, j'ai du du merder y'a quelques temps entre
>> stable/testing/backports)

Evidemment si tout est mélangé, ça risque de ne pas le fai re.



Oui, le pinning était bon, mais suite a des problèmes de dispos
des serveurs chez debian, j'avais commenté les sources "stable", je me
suis aperçu _après_ quelques full-upgrade de mon erreur.
ça va testing est de plus en plus stable : [mode vendredi]squeeze
sortira-t-elle aussi un 14 février :-D ? [/mode vendredi]


tu peux tjrs essayer de voir ce que dit un: strace saned -d128
mais à mon avis le temps de trouver où ça merdouille, soit tu
réinstalles propre, soit tu migres en sid.





Bol monstrueux, a la fin (pendant l'execution de scanimage -L) :

not found : libsane-hpaio.so => inclu dans le paquet hplip

aptitude install hplip

et hop le scanner a été détecté par scanimage (en user) depuis un poste
distant, mais pas en local !?

$ groups
gbulot dialout cdrom floppy audio video plugdev powerdev scanner netdev
bacula



--
Cordialement
Grégory BULOT

--
Lisez la FAQ de la liste avant de poser une question :
http://wiki.debian.org/fr/FrenchLists

Pour vous DESABONNER, envoyez un message avec comme objet "unsubscribe"
vers
En cas de soucis, contactez EN ANGLAIS
Archive: http://lists.debian.org/
Avatar
Jean-Yves F. Barbier
On Fri, 31 Dec 2010 14:13:30 +0100, Grégory Bulot
wrote:

...
> Par contre, ça, ça n'est pas normal, mais ça correspond à ce que tu
> as dis: pas de détection de la bête (==pas de device cr éé)

au moins de ce côté c'est cohérent (culte de la pensé e posistive)



moi, je cultive la pensée résistive... et dès fois transisto rienne.

...
> tu peux tjrs essayer de voir ce que dit un: strace saned -d128
> mais à mon avis le temps de trouver où ça merdouille, so it tu
> réinstalles propre, soit tu migres en sid.

Bol monstrueux, a la fin (pendant l'execution de scanimage -L) :



Nan, c'est du dépannage, pas du bol.

not found : libsane-hpaio.so => inclu dans le paquet hplip
aptitude install hplip

et hop le scanner a été détecté par scanimage (en use r) depuis un poste
distant, mais pas en local !?



Alors c'est soit que le daemon n'est pas en attente sur localhost alors
que le client l'y cherche, soit que le client est mal configuré
(ou vice versa)

--
Aliquid melius quam pessimum optimum non est.

--
Lisez la FAQ de la liste avant de poser une question :
http://wiki.debian.org/fr/FrenchLists

Pour vous DESABONNER, envoyez un message avec comme objet "unsubscribe"
vers
En cas de soucis, contactez EN ANGLAIS
Archive: http://lists.debian.org/
Avatar
Grégory Bulot
Bonjour, Bonsoir,

Le Fri, 31 Dec 2010 14:27:45 +0100, Jean-Yves F. Barbier, vous avez
écrit :


Alors c'est soit que le daemon n'est pas en attente sur localhost
alors que le client l'y cherche, soit que le client est mal configurà ©
(ou vice versa)





# netstat -peanut | grep 6566
tcp 0 0 0.0.0.0:6566 0.0.0.0:*
LISTEN 0 56350 19610/inetd


ça me semble bon pourtant (c'est identique à l'autre pc en tout c as)

Note :
accessoirement, sur l'autre poste qui fonctionne (en full lenny) :
video:~# ls -al /dev/sg*|grep sca
ls: ne peut accéder /dev/sg*: Aucun fichier ou répertoire de ce t ype


--
Cordialement
Grégory BULOT

--
Lisez la FAQ de la liste avant de poser une question :
http://wiki.debian.org/fr/FrenchLists

Pour vous DESABONNER, envoyez un message avec comme objet "unsubscribe"
vers
En cas de soucis, contactez EN ANGLAIS
Archive: http://lists.debian.org/
Avatar
Jean-Yves F. Barbier
On Fri, 31 Dec 2010 14:55:19 +0100, Grégory Bulot
wrote:

...
# netstat -peanut | grep 6566
tcp 0 0 0.0.0.0:6566 0.0.0.0:*
LISTEN 0 56350 19610/inetd
ça me semble bon pourtant (c'est identique à l'autre pc en tout cas)



Alors vérifie les permissions et la conf.

Note :
accessoirement, sur l'autre poste qui fonctionne (en full lenny) :
video:~# ls -al /dev/sg*|grep sca
ls: ne peut accéder /dev/sg*: Aucun fichier ou répertoire de ce type



Awai, c'est sans doute parce que mon scanner est en SCSI, une bonne âm e pour
fournir le device créé en USB?

--
He who farts in church must sit in his own pew.

--
Lisez la FAQ de la liste avant de poser une question :
http://wiki.debian.org/fr/FrenchLists

Pour vous DESABONNER, envoyez un message avec comme objet "unsubscribe"
vers
En cas de soucis, contactez EN ANGLAIS
Archive: http://lists.debian.org/
Avatar
Grégory Bulot
Bonjour, Bonsoir,

Le Fri, 31 Dec 2010 15:18:51 +0100, Jean-Yves F. Barbier, vous avez
écrit :

Alors vérifie les permissions et la conf.



c'est déjà fait (je crois avoir tout comparé)
- /etc/saned.d : dll.conf, saned.conf, net.conf, dll.d/hplip
groups : identique sur les 2 pcs ayant un scanner

mon seul soucis c'est avec udev, j'ai ajouté la dernière ligne ma is
elle ne semble pas prise en compte (reste en mode 0664 au lieu 0666)
après débranchement/rebranchement

cat /etc/udev/rules.d/024_hpmud.rules


ACTION!="add", GOTO="hpmud_rules_end"
SUBSYSTEM=="ppdev", OWNER="lp", GROUP="scanner"
SUBSYSTEM=="usb", ENV{DEVTYPE}=="usb_device", GOTO="pid_test"
SUBSYSTEM!="usb_device", GOTO="hpmud_rules_end"

LABEL="pid_test"

# Check for AiO products (0x03f0xx11).
SYSFS{idVendor}=="03f0", SYSFS{idProduct}=="??11", OWNER="lp",
GROUP="scanner" # Check for Photosmart products (0x03f0xx02).
SYSFS{idVendor}=="03f0", SYSFS{idProduct}=="??02", OWNER="lp",
GROUP="scanner" # Check for Business Inkjet products (0x03f0xx12).
SYSFS{idVendor}=="03f0", SYSFS{idProduct}=="??12", OWNER="lp",
GROUP="scanner" # Check for Deskjet products (0x03f0xx04).
SYSFS{idVendor}=="03f0", SYSFS{idProduct}=="??04", OWNER="lp",
GROUP="scanner" # Check for LaserJet products (0x03f0xx17).
SYSFS{idVendor}=="03f0", SYSFS{idProduct}=="??17", OWNER="lp",
GROUP="scanner"

LABEL="hpmud_rules_end"


SYSFS{idVendor}=="03f0", SYSFS{idProduct}=="??11", OWNER="lp",
GROUP="scanner", MODE="0666"


--
Cordialement
Grégory BULOT

--
Lisez la FAQ de la liste avant de poser une question :
http://wiki.debian.org/fr/FrenchLists

Pour vous DESABONNER, envoyez un message avec comme objet "unsubscribe"
vers
En cas de soucis, contactez EN ANGLAIS
Archive: http://lists.debian.org/
Avatar
Jean-Yves F. Barbier
On Fri, 31 Dec 2010 16:00:10 +0100, Grégory Bulot
wrote:



Bonjour, Bonsoir,



Bonjoir,

...
mon seul soucis c'est avec udev, j'ai ajouté la dernière ligne mais
elle ne semble pas prise en compte (reste en mode 0664 au lieu 0666)
après débranchement/rebranchement



déjà eu ça en sid il-y-a longtemps (pire: 0600), résolu comme un goret
avec un script dans /etc/init.d qui rétablissait les perms le temps que
ça soit corrigé.

--
Tout homme qui dirige, qui fait quelque chose, a contre lui ceux qui
voudraient faire la même chose, ceux qui font précisément le contraire et
surtout la grande armée des gens d'autant plus sévères qu'il s ne font rien du
tout. -- J. Clarétie

--
Lisez la FAQ de la liste avant de poser une question :
http://wiki.debian.org/fr/FrenchLists

Pour vous DESABONNER, envoyez un message avec comme objet "unsubscribe"
vers
En cas de soucis, contactez EN ANGLAIS
Archive: http://lists.debian.org/
1 2